sim卡怎么写入eap服务器
时间: 2024-10-11 19:13:57 浏览: 10
SIM卡通常不会直接写入EAP服务器,因为它们是用来存储用户的身份信息和服务数据的物理载体,而EAP(Extensible Authentication Protocol)是一种用于网络访问认证的安全协议,它运行在客户端设备(如手机、电脑)和接入点(如无线路由器或企业网络)之间。
如果需要在连接网络时通过SIM卡进行身份验证,通常涉及的过程如下:
1. **身份验证请求**:当你尝试连接到需要身份验证的网络时,你的设备会发起一个EAP请求,指定使用SIM卡作为凭证。
2. **SIM卡响应**:手机接收到这个请求后,会在安全模块中读取用户的预存SIM卡信息,如IMSI(国际移动用户识别码)或者PIN/PUK(解锁码)。
3. **EAP服务器处理**:这些信息会被发送到EAP服务器,服务器会检查这些信息的有效性和匹配度,并可能进一步触发短信验证码或其他形式的二次验证。
4. **身份确认**:如果你提供的信息有效,EAP服务器会返回一个成功的响应,允许你连接到网络。
5. **加密通信**:一旦连接建立,网络通信通常会通过SSL/TLS等协议进行加密,保护数据传输安全。
请注意,实际操作过程中可能会涉及到运营商的定制设置以及特定的设备驱动支持,不是所有环境都能直接在SIM卡上写入EAP服务器信息。如果你是在企业环境中实施此类服务,可能需要专业的IT人员来进行配置和管理。
相关问题
eap-sim搭建测试环境
要搭建eap-sim的测试环境,首先需要准备一台运行认证服务器的计算机。认证服务器可以选择开源的FreeRADIUS或者商业的认证服务器产品。然后,需要一台支持eap-sim认证的移动设备,例如智能手机或平板电脑。
在认证服务器上,首先需要安装和配置FreeRADIUS或者其他认证服务器软件。然后,需要生成一个自签名的认证服务器证书,并将其导入到认证服务器。接下来,需要创建一个eap-sim的配置文件,设置认证服务器的参数,如IMSI(国际移动用户识别码)池、密钥等。
在移动设备上,需要使用支持eap-sim的认证客户端应用程序。例如在Android系统上,可以使用EAP-SIM认证应用程序。在应用程序中,需要输入认证服务器的IP地址和端口号,并导入认证服务器证书。
接下来,需要配置认证服务器和移动设备之间的网络连接。可以通过WiFi或3G/4G网络实现连接。确保认证服务器和移动设备在同一局域网内或具有互联网访问权限。
最后,启动认证服务器和移动设备上的认证客户端应用程序。在移动设备上选择eap-sim认证,并输入移动设备的IMSI号码。认证客户端应用程序将使用IMSI号码与认证服务器进行通信,并完成认证过程。
完成上述步骤后,即可搭建成功eap-sim的测试环境。可以通过移动设备进行eap-sim认证的测试,并验证认证服务器的功能和性能。可以测试认证成功、认证失败和异常情况下的处理等。
eap8266连接服务器的流程
ESP8266连接服务器的流程如下:
1. 配置ESP8266模块:在ESP8266模块上设置Wi-Fi网络的SSID和密码,以及服务器的IP地址和端口号。
2. 建立TCP连接:ESP8266模块通过TCP/IP协议与服务器建立连接,可以使用AT命令或者编程方式实现。
3. 发送数据:ESP8266向服务器发送数据,可以是HTTP请求、JSON数据等。
4. 接收数据:服务器处理请求后,返回响应数据,ESP8266接收响应数据并进行处理。
5. 断开连接:ESP8266与服务器断开连接,释放资源。
需要注意的是,ESP8266模块的工作方式有两种:AT指令模式和编程模式,具体选择哪种方式取决于具体的应用场景和需求。